The Pete Petersen Basketball League was founded 69 years ago by Don Petersen, then a 17-year-old caretaker at St. Pat's School. For many years it was known as the Knights of Columbus Basketball League and was renamed when Don passed away in 2014. Currently, we have 500 children on 38 teams that enjoy an 18-game season of basketball for $10. With more than 100 volunteers overseeing the operation, we remain committed to Don's dream of providing a safe and affordable place to learn how much fun the game can be.
